Your recent XP gains have been pretty good, however you should work on adding some dailies to your routine, namely Warbands, Tree Runs, Daily Challenges and Divine Locations. You can remove Big Chin from your routine as it's kind of useless due to Crystallize not working in the private Hunter areas. You can find more info about efficient dailies on the first page of this thread. I would also strongly recommend training Mining thru Warbands instead if possible.
